Quantitative lab filter paper is a type of specialized filtration medium used in scientific laboratories and industrial settings for various filtration applications. It is designed to quantitatively separate and collect solid particles from liquids or gases based on their size and composition. Here are some key characteristics and uses of quantitative lab filter paper:
Filtration Efficiency: Quantitative lab filter paper is known for its high filtration efficiency, making it suitable for applications where precise particle separation and collection are essential.
Particle Retention: These filter papers are manufactured with specific pore sizes to retain particles of defined sizes. The choice of filter paper depends on the size of particles you want to separate.
Composition: They are typically made from cellulose fibers or a combination of cellulose and other materials like glass fibers.The choice of material depends on the chemical compatibility and intended use.
Weight and Thickness: Filter papers come in various weights and thicknesses to accommodate different filtration requirements. Thicker papers may have greater particle-holding capacity.
Gravimetric Analysis: Quantitative filter papers are often used in gravimetric analysis, where the collected solid particles are weighed to determine their mass or concentration in the original sample.
Applications: These filter papers find applications in a wide range of industries, including pharmaceuticals, environmental analysis, food and beverage processing, and chemical manufacturing, among others.
Grades and Types: Quantitative filter papers are available in various grades, such as ashless, hardened, and non-hardened, to suit different filtration needs and chemical compatibility requirements.
Wet Strength: Some filter papers are designed to have wet strength, allowing them to maintain their structural integrity even when wet, which is essential for certain filtration processes.
Specialized Varieties: In addition to standard quantitative lab filter papers, there are specialized varieties, such as membrane filters, which offer precise filtration capabilities for applications like microbiology and air quality monitoring.
Compatibility: It's important to choose the right type of filter paper based on the chemicals and substances being filtered, as well as the desired filtration speed and efficiency.
Quantitative lab filter paper plays a crucial role in ensuring the accuracy and reliability of laboratory analyses and industrial processes that involve separating solids from liquids or gases. Proper selection and use of filter papers are essential to achieve accurate results in various scientific and industrial applications.

Gravimetric Analysis
Quantitative filter papers are the choice for gravimetric analysis. High purity hardened filters have a high wet-strength and are chemical resistant to handle vacuum filtration or acid/alkali solutions.
Ashing Weighing Analysis
The role of quantitative filter paper is mainly used for ashing weighing analysis experiments after filtration. The ash weight after ashing of each filter paper is a fixed value.

This Whatman 7.0cm, grade 6, cellulose filter paper is used in qualitative analytical techniques to determine and identify materials. It has excellent fine particle filtration (3µm) in the qualitative range. It is capable of retaining the fine precipitates encountered in chemical analysis. This filter paper is twice as fast as grade 5, with similar fine particle retention. It is often specified for boiler water analysis applications. It is an excellent clarifying filter for cloudy suspensions and for water and soil analysis. Retention: 3µm. Diameter: 7.0cm. 100/Pack. Whatman #: 1006-070.
